This was really cool. I love geometric puzzle games. I played a while and stopped when I felt like I could keep going indefinitely. Ironically it seems to get easier over time past a certain point because you have so much accumulated edge area to build off of, which is interesting. It makes me wonder how you could limit this on the design side elegantly... anyways, lotta fun, nice job!

(1 edit) (+3)

OMG that is a crazy score!  Yeah it's an interesting question, a simple solution would be to reduce the number of extra tiles you gain when creating a perfect tile, but it might seriously limit the size an island can become. Maybe reducing the perfect tile reward and implementing another means of gaining additional tiles such as completing quests like connecting X number of desert triangles or X number of forest triangles could be a nice solution as it can become harder to complete the quests the longer you play. I'll think some more about it and maybe add a little update after the rating period :)) Thanks for playing!
